Halloween: Canadians’ Habits in 2025

Are Canadians Really into Halloween in 2025?

A recent Leger study looked into this.

Here are the results:

At a glance

70% of Canadians plan to spend about the same as last year.

Regarding spending on candy,

  • 28% plan to spend between $20 and $50,
  • 11% between $50 and $75, and
  • 6% between $75 and $100.
